training
fitness components
1500m:
aerobic power - event is prolonged and performed at moderate to high intensity
anaerobic capacity- sprint finish
muscular endurance - leg muscles sustain repeated contractions
speed
triple jump: muscular power - explosive power for the jump
speed - for the run approach
muscular strength
agility
anaerobic capacity - explosive action so need to resynthesise ATP at a fast rate
fitness testing
1500:
yoyo intermittent recovery test, coopers 12 min run would be appropriate for the 1500m run - aerobic power
accuracy of this fitness testing data can be maximised through strictly following the procedural instructions, whilst reliability can be maximised conducting the tests under the same conditions
triple jump:
vertical jump test, 20 metre sprint test would be appropriate for triple jump

training methods
1500m:
long interval training - 1:1, 80% MHR, 3x10
HIIT training - 90% MHR, 1:1, 3x10
continuous training - 75% MHR, 20 min run
fartlek training - 7-9 RPE, 20 min run
improve aerobic power
triple jump:
resistance (MP) - 40% 1RM, 3x7, explosive
plyometrics training (MP) - maxmimal, 3x10, lowerbody
resiatance (MS) - 80% 1RM, 3x3, lower body
chronic adaptations
1500m:
aerobic adaptations: increased left ventricle, decreased heart rate, increased capilarisation increased tidal volume, increased ventilatory efficiency, increased pulmonary diffusion, increased mitochondria, increased myoglobin
triple jump:
anaerobic adaptions: increased ATP-PC stores, increased glycolytic enzymes, improved lactate tolerance, increased motor unit recruitment, increased firing rates of motor units,
